Mental Health Services for Children Who Have Experienced Traumatic Events

The Children’s Place offers four distinct programs to provide a holistic continuum of care for young children. Our multidisciplinary approach to healing makes it possible for children to heal from their traumatic experiences. Assessments & Screenings

Experiencing traumatic stress early in life can negatively impact the development of the young brain. To ensure early identification and interventions, the diagnostic team offers developmental and behavioral screenings for children 6 weeks through 6 years old.

Counseling Center

During weekly appointments, our highly-skilled therapists offer individual or family therapy for children ages one to eight who have experienced life’s biggest hurts. Children learn how to process and cope with the big feelings which typically occur when navigating the hurts of loss, divorce, accidents, abuse or any of life’s hardships.

Family Support

Caring for a child who has experienced traumatic events is hard work. Through caregiver groups and individualized parenting services, adults receive encouragement and education to raise happy and healthy children.

Day Treatment

Designed to address the whole child, this daily program incorporates mental health therapy in an early educational environment. Children receive mental health, social-emotional, developmental and educational services so they can thrive in a traditional classroom setting or daycare.
